We use cookies. Find out more about it here. By continuing to browse this site you are agreeing to our use of cookies.

Job posting has expired

#alert
Back to search results

Principal Software Engineer, Publishing Production Platform

American Chemical Society
relocation assistance
United States, Ohio, Columbus
2540 Olentangy River Rd (Show on map)
March 25, 2024
Principal Software Engineer, Publishing Production Platform

Date: Mar 20, 2024

Location:
Columbus, OH, US, 43202

Company:
American Chemical Society

The American Chemical Society (ACS), a mission-driven non-profit organization with a commercial Publications division, is seeking a Senior Technical Managerto help define and implement a future state technology publishing platform supporting its core digital scientific Journal and Book publishing program. Based in Columbus, Ohio, the Publications Applications and Technologies Solutions (PATS) team has an existing mission-critical journal and book digital production platform that requires updates to maintain stable operations while migrating to a modern architecture to meet new and current business needs.

This is a unique opportunity to directly contribute to the technological transformation of a mission critical function that enables world-changing research.

Primary responsibilities include but are not limited to the following:

* Serves as a technology & simplification thought leader across Publications IT.

*Technical design, technical leadership, consultation (40%), directing and consulting with junior developers and contractors (20%), application support (20%), strategic and technical planning (20%).

* Provides advice on technical direction, systems development strategy, and future state architectures.

* Evaluates new and existing application and development technologies and assists in the onboarding of those technologies and practices to the ACS.

* Works with the leadership team to proactively assess and implement strategic technical direction for the Publications IT department.

* Creates high-level plans and designs and executes the delivery of technology solutions to business needs, working with business and IT staff.

* Learns, evaluates, supports, and improves the existing journal and book production platform.

* Successfully designs, develops, tests, implements, and manages sophisticated business solutions with acceptable total costs of ownership.

* Provides technical leadership and development expectations to both on-site and remote engineers, often managing the tasks assigned to junior developers.

* Develops and updates technical documentation and facilitates knowledge transfer across the team.

* Effectively collaborates with architectural and technical operations teams to provide continuity from design to runtime.

* Provides direction on recommended best practices for software development and supporting the adherence to those practices.

Required Education:

* College degree in Computer Science, Software Engineering, or related field. Equivalent experience may be considered as a substitute.

Required Skills/Certifications:

* Proficient in large-scale updates to existing and new solutions including evaluating, selecting, and implementing new technologies.

* Technical skills in the following areas:



  • Content management and workflow technologies.
  • Knowledge of SQL Server and MarkLogic.
  • Unix/Linux and Windows environments, Java, web development
  • Content delivery and exchange between numerous third-party applications and vendors.


* Demonstrated ability to learn and master new technologies and concepts and apply them to the workplace.

* Familiarity with the Atlassian suite of tools such as JIRA, Confluence or equivalent.

* Continuous improvement mindset: ability to improve business value delivered over time as well as team capabilities and velocity.

* Excellent written, verbal and presentation skills, to work well in a medium-sized development team with business users and technical staff.

* Ability to influence and gain commitment across organizational levels.

* Future thinker, capable of being a bold leader to recommend and implement new technologies and methodologies that will benefit the ACS.

* Proven leadership and technical project leadership skills.

* Possess critical thinking, analytical and problem-solving skills.

* Ability to plan work and deliver accurate estimates.

* Ability to work collaboratively with business partners and IT to implement desired solutions.

* Ability to drive investigations into and managing third party software providers and partners.

* Ability to effectively lead and guide others to achieve project objectives.

* Ability to quickly adapt to and respond to new project requirements.

* Ability to work with and guide global, remote resources.

Required Experience:

*A minimum of 10 years of experience with an application development team, preferably in a content-production-related field, such as information management. Experience with digital publishing, especially of books and scientific journals, is preferred.

* Demonstrated experience and capabilities for application and technical project team leadership, system and application design, system and application architectures, and hands-on development in cloud and on-premises environments.

* Experience with data and application governances.

* Experience with Agile and other software development lifecycles.

* Experience with cloud technology.

This position is based in the Columbus, Ohio office. ACS employees work a hybrid work schedule, consisting of working onsite, three days per week. ACS employees are in the office on Tuesday and Wednesday with the third in-office day scheduled in consultation with the manager. While always welcome to work in the office, employees may work the other two days of the week from a location of their choice. New employees are immediately eligible for this hybrid work arrangement. ACS offers relocation assistance, if applicable.

EEO/Minority/Female/Disabled/Veteran





Nearest Major Market: Columbus



Job Segment:
Cloud, Computer Science, Developer, Java, Linux, Technology

(web-5bb4b78774-k29v8)